首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在Oracle SQL中选择字符串中特定单词之后的子字符串?

在Oracle SQL中选择字符串中特定单词之后的子字符串,可以使用SUBSTR和INSTR函数的组合来实现。

首先,使用INSTR函数找到特定单词在字符串中的位置。INSTR函数接受三个参数:源字符串、要查找的子字符串以及开始搜索的位置。通过将开始搜索的位置设置为1,可以从字符串的开头开始搜索。

然后,使用SUBSTR函数截取从特定单词之后到字符串末尾的子字符串。SUBSTR函数接受三个参数:源字符串、开始位置和要截取的长度。开始位置可以设置为特定单词的位置加上特定单词的长度,以获取特定单词之后的位置。

以下是一个示例查询:

代码语言:txt
复制
SELECT SUBSTR(column_name, INSTR(column_name, '特定单词') + LENGTH('特定单词'))
FROM table_name;

请将上述示例中的column_name替换为要查询的列名,table_name替换为要查询的表名,以及特定单词替换为要查找的特定单词。

这样,查询结果将返回特定单词之后的子字符串。

对于Oracle SQL中的字符串处理,腾讯云提供了云数据库 TencentDB for Oracle,它是一种高性能、高可用性的云数据库解决方案。您可以通过以下链接了解更多关于腾讯云数据库 TencentDB for Oracle的信息:TencentDB for Oracle产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Enterprise Library 4 数据访问应用程序块

应用程序块包含对存储过程和内联 SQL 支持。常规内部(housekeep)处理,管理连接、创建并缓存参数,都封装在应用程序块方法。...数据访问应用程序块另一个特性是,应用程序代码可以由一个 ADO.NET 连接字符串名字,"Customer" 或者 "Inventory" ,而引向一个特定数据。...它包含了用于 SQL Server 和 Oracle 数据库类。这些类包含了提供特定数据库特性参数处理和游标的实现代码。...使用数据访问应用程序块开发应用程序 首先解释了如何配置应用程序块并将它添加到应用程序。然后,在关键场景,解释了如何在特定场景中使用应用程序块,例如获取单个项或者使用 DataSet 对象获取多行。...考虑后端关系数据库管理系统(RDBMS)大小写敏感。例如,在 SQL Server 2000 字符串比较是大小写不敏感,但是在 Oracle 8i 和 DB2 是大小写敏感

1.8K60
  • 【Flink】第二十八篇:Flink SQL 与 Apache Calcite

    领域专用语言(Domain Specific Language): 能够高效描述特定领域世界观和方法论语言。例如,SQL、HTML & CSS、Regex。...词法解析器 Lexer: 词法分析是指在计算机科学,将字符序列转换为单词(Token)过程。 3. 语法解析器 Parser: 语法解析器通常作为 编译器 或 解释器 出现。...实现这个需求,需要按照java规范,将源码每个词法(public、class、package)、类名、包名等转换成对应字节码。那么如何取得这些词、类名、包名、变量名呢?...如数字、单引号字符串、双引号字符串、各个进制写法等 字符,单字符(!、~、=、>等)、双字符(>=、<=)等 关键字,Javaclass、package、import、public等 2....建设者是Julian Hyde,曾经是 Oracle 引擎主要开发者、SQLStream 公司创始人和主架构师、Pentaho BI 套件 OLAP 部分架构师和主要开发者。

    2.3K32

    SQL反模式学习笔记17 全文搜索

    目标:全文搜索 使用SQL搜索关键字,同时保证快速和精确,依旧是相当地困难。 SQL一个基本原理(以及SQL所继承关系原理)就是一列单个数据是原子性。...正则表达式可能会为单词边界提供一个模式来解决单词匹配问题。 如何识别反模式:当出现以下情况时,可能是反模式   1、如何在like表达式2个通配符之间插入一个变量?   ...2、如何写一个正则表达式来检查一个字符串是否包含多个单词、不包含一个特定单词,或者包含给定单词任意形式?   3、网站搜索功能在增加了很多文档进去之后不可理喻。...1、MySQL全文索引:可以再一个类型为Char、varchar或者Text列上定义一个全文索引。然后使用Match函数来搜索。   ...2、Oracle文本索引:Context、Ctxcat、Ctxxpath、Ctxule。   3、SQL Server全文搜索:使用Contains()操作符来使用全文索引。

    1.2K10

    知识点:匹配字符串串,并让串红色显示、格式化输出json、元素点击之后hover失效、word-wrap:break-word和word-break:break-all

    匹配字符串串,并让串红色显示、格式化输出json、元素点击之后hover失效、word-wrap:break-word和word-break:break-all 五、匹配特定字符串,让其突出显示...六、格式化输出json JSON.stringify(object,null,2) JSON.stringify(object,undefined,2) 其中第三个参数表示指定缩进用空白字符串...七、jQuery,某个元素被点击之后hover失效 使用jQueryclick为某元素加上css样式,之后该元素原有的hover事件失效,原因是click加上css权值比外联css权值大。...八、word-wrap:break-word和word-break:break-all word-wrap:break-word表示超出部分按单词截断,会保持单词完整。...word-break:break-all则会从单词中间截断。

    72920

    Oracle 数据库数据质量运算符

    Oracle数据库23c引入了FUZZY_MATCH和PHONIC_ENCODE数据质量运算符来执行模糊字符串匹配。 UTL_MATCH软件包在Oracle 11g Release 2得到支持。...它包含各种有助于测试字符串之间相似性/差异性级别的函数。在Oracle 23cFUZZY_MATCH和PHONIC_ENCODE运算符扩展了数据库模糊字符串匹配功能。...WHOLE_WORD_MATCH 对应于 Oracle Enterprise Data Quality 单词匹配百分比或计数比较。...它计算以单词(而不是字母)作为匹配单位两个短语 LEVENSHTEIN 或编辑距离。 LONGEST_COMMON_SUBSTRING 查找两个字符串之间最长公共字符串。...SQL> EDIT_TOLERANCE关键字可以与WHOLE_WORD_MATCH算法一起使用。容差是指一个单词可能不同字符百分比,同时仍将其视为同一个单词

    21210

    Oracle字符串函数

    相同,比如: VARCHAR2数值被限制为2000字符(ORACLE 8为4000字符),而CHAR数值被限制为255字符(在ORACLE8是2000).当在过程性语句中使用时,它们可以被赋值给...使用位置:过程性语句和SQL语句。 l INITCAP 语法:INITCAP(string) 功能:返回字符串每个单词第一个字母大写而单词其他字母小写string。...l NLS_INITCAP 语法:NLS_INITCAP(string[,nlsparams]) 功能:返回字符串每个单词第一个字母大写而单词其他字母小写string,nlsparams...替换,如果没有指定replace_str,所有的string字符串search_str都将被删除。.... to_str不能为空.Oracle把空字符串认为是NULL,并且如果TRANSLATE任何参数为NULL,那么结果也是NULL.

    1K20

    这是我见过最有用Mysql面试题,面试了无数公司总结(内附答案)

    SELECT:从数据库中选择特定数据 INSERT:将新记录插入表 UPDATE:更新现有记录 DELETE:从表删除现有记录 15. SQL中有哪些不同DCL命令?...数据库查询可以是选择查询或动作查询。 24.什么是查询? 查询是另一个查询SQL查询。它是Select语句子集, 其返回值用于过滤主查询条件。 25.查询类型是什么?...查询有两种类型: 1.关联:在SQL数据库查询,关联查询是使用外部查询值来完成查询。因为相关子查询要求首先执行外部查询,所以相关子查询必须为外部查询每一行运行一次。...SQL字符串函数是什么? SQL字符串函数主要用于字符串操作。...SQL SELECT语句顺序如下 选择,从,在哪里,分组依据,拥有,订购依据。 89.如何在SQL显示当前日期? 在SQL,有一个名为GetDate()内置函数,该函数有助于返回当前日期。

    27.1K20

    Oracle基础 各种语句定义格式

    (_表示一个字符,%表示0个或多个字符) 若字符串包含“_”“%”,可使用escape ‘\’, like ‘%s\_t%’ escape ‘\’用来匹配“s_t”字符串 集合运算符 4....、 rtrim剪切字符及其右侧字符、 lrtrim剪切字符及其左侧字符、 soundex、发音相似单词 substr、字符截取 chr、ascii码代表字符 ascii、字符ascii码...截去小数、 round四舍五入、 exp常数e次幂、 mod余数、 ln自然对数值、 log以10为底对数值、 vsize存储空间、 greatest一组值最大、 least一组值最大...,对记录访问是基于rowid,这是存取表数据最快方法。...after:数据库动作之后触发器执行 instead of:触发器被触发,但相应操作并不被执行,而运行仅是触发器SQL语句本身。用在 使不可被修改视图能够支持修改。

    87510

    oracle操作

    一,权限管理 在为一个Oracle数据库系统创建用户之后,这些用户既不能与数据库服务器连接,也不能做任何事情,除非他们具有执行特定数据库操作权限....oracle内置权限:(SELECT * FROM SYSTEM_PRIVILEGE_MAP查); Oracle数据库访问权限类型共有两种: 系统权限: 允许用户执行特定数据库动作,创建表、创建索引...、连接实例等 对象权限: 允许用户操纵一些特定对象,读取视图,可更新某些列、执行存储过程等 常用系统权限 create session...PL/SQLOracle数据库对SQL语句扩展,增加了编程语言特点..../SQL数据类型 必须有EXECUTE权限 2.存储过程 用于在数据库完成特定操作或者任务 create or replace PROCEDURE name [(parameter,…)]

    1.5K20

    Java判断一个字符串是否包含某个字符

    在很多应用场景文本处理、数据验证、用户输入处理等,都需要用到字符串操作。 1.2 文章目的与适用读者 本文目的是介绍如何在Java判断一个字符串是否包含某个字符。...在实际开发,通常会优先考虑使用contains方法,因为它更简洁且易于理解。如果需要更复杂操作,统计字符出现次数,则可以选择字符串转换为字符数组方法。 3....通过Pattern和Matcher类,我们可以在字符串搜索特定模式,并根据需要进行更复杂操作。 这些高级搜索技巧在处理更复杂字符串搜索任务时非常有用,文本分析、数据验证、模式匹配等场景。...4.2 文本搜索与处理 在文本处理应用,可能需要搜索特定单词或短语,并进行高亮显示或其他处理。...4.3 字符串安全性检查 在处理用户输入时,需要检查并移除或转义可能引起安全问题字符,SQL注入攻击中特殊字符。

    23210

    SqlAlchemy 2.0 中文文档(二)

    CTE文档字符串包含有关这些附加模式详细信息。 在这两种情况下,查询和 CTE 在 SQL 层面上都被命名为“匿名”名称。在 Python 代码,我们根本不需要提供这些名称。...这与在 ORM 实体查询/CTEs 引入方式相同,首先创建我们想要实体到查询临时“映射”,然后从新实体中选择,就像它是任何其他映射类一样。...SQL 函数,count、now、max、concat 包括它们自己预打包版本,这些版本提供了适当类型信息,并在某些情况下提供特定于后端 SQL 生成。...CTE文档字符串包含了有关这些附加模式详细信息。 在这两种情况下,查询和 CTE 都在 SQL 级别使用“匿名”名称命名。在 Python 代码,我们根本不需要提供这些名称。...- 在 ORM 查询指南 ORM 实体从联合中选择 前面的示例说明了如何在给定两个Table对象情况下构造一个 UNION,然后返回数据库行。

    39410
    领券